Skip to content

Instantly share code, notes, and snippets.

@Whateverable
Created June 13, 2017 03:32
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save Whateverable/704d8c9ddfc94e22b53d8d3379336683 to your computer and use it in GitHub Desktop.
Save Whateverable/704d8c9ddfc94e22b53d8d3379336683 to your computer and use it in GitHub Desktop.
bisectable6
my $list := eager gather LABEL: for 1..4 -> $index { take $index; next LABEL; }; say $list.perl
Bisecting: 2370 revisions left to test after this (roughly 11 steps)
[8b40d1b14de0affe8b53df89a48f13227ddfbf05] Make the ShapeIterator role more usable
»»»»» Testing 8b40d1b14de0affe8b53df89a48f13227ddfbf05
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
»»»»» Testing 9a74cd0e51405ba4e2f1fbf7f525b631bf2d7d37
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
»»»»» Testing 5e459bce123c0e68a9431a3f69f33e40f07cc97e
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
»»»»» Testing 280c34f27b77a54cbcd09a95bd844c0df05d1938
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
»»»»» Testing 8f4f515f94187f0fb74972043e2edcaedf989700
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
»»»»» Testing 79b8ab9d3f9a5499e8a7859f34b4499fb352ac13
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
»»»»» Testing f28762816cece9eefb120495eb99b5c5426a96e5
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
»»»»» Testing 9151ebaaec066eeecef78def30985e0edc5961df
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
»»»»» Testing 52d39576f710fa28c49e878a6b4480abfee2b0b3
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
»»»»» Testing 0095cd8e27efb24395946f07071a359e6c648727
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
»»»»» Testing de74f173c9cffbc7dc7f41d4509f61555a8470f1
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
»»»»» Testing abfb52be1db8ece12fb6a335ec073496846dc058
»»»»» Script output:
(1, 2, 3, 4)
»»»»» Script exit code: 0
»»»»» Bisecting by exit code
»»»»» Current exit code is 0, exit code on “old” revision is 0
»»»»» If exit code is not the same as on “old” revision, this revision will be marked as “new”
»»»»» Therefore, marking this revision as “old”
»»»»» -------------------------------------------------------------------------
46b11f54c03511a96d4db08213d55bc9c78623c7 is the first new commit
commit 46b11f54c03511a96d4db08213d55bc9c78623c7
Author: Timo Paulssen <timonator@perpetuum-immobile.de>
Date: Tue Jun 13 02:14:43 2017 +0200
bring back for ^N { } optimization again
:040000 040000 20ea92288a53500c46172332854b262b522f133d 56cbe9f4ad2d172c67911cc95ffc07af142c7a1f M src
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ment